Output 36986518401d787c9c087fbe995a2b678a72472e5d7c0dc7114cde3084a2efdf:14

value
655716
script pubkey
OP_0 OP_PUSHBYTES_20 38cf85e06778a61cbf554d40bc46541add25dccc
address
bc1q8r8ctcr80znpe064f4qtc3j5rtwjthxvhyxj3z
transaction
36986518401d787c9c087fbe995a2b678a72472e5d7c0dc7114cde3084a2efdf
confirmations
52265
spent
true